Power BI 勉強会 / Power Query 秘密特訓「虎の穴」 #2 まとめ

Power Query 秘密特訓「虎の穴」 #2 Road to Power Query NINJA 2019年2月2日(土) まとめです。
4
Takeshi Kagata / Power Platform 部 Power BI 科 🛌💤 @PowerBIxyz

んとねー、今日はねー、持ち寄った課題解決などしてる。これどうすんのさってつぶやきがあったら反応するかもだ。 Power Query 秘密特訓「虎の穴」 #2 powerbi.connpass.com/event/117472/ #PowerBI #PowerQuery #PBIJP

2019-02-02 11:15:41
Yellow11 @br_Yellow11

Power Queryはデスクトップでもサービスでも使える。 VBAはOfficeが起動していないと動かない。 サービス上で使えるのが大きいと思う今日この頃 #PowerBI #PowerQuery #PBIJP

2019-02-02 13:09:16
Yellow11 @br_Yellow11

ExcelとPower BIのPower Queryはバージョンが違う。 出来る事はほぼ一緒だが、スペックが異なる。 #PowerBI #PowerQuery #PBIJP

2019-02-02 13:10:54
スミレ @Sumire_Neko

excelは テーブル範囲からとって vbaは列がないとエラーになる対策要とか powerbiはそうでなく 数式バーは必ず出して 何をしたら何になるか見て

2019-02-02 13:15:27
Yellow11 @br_Yellow11

データを取り込むにあたり、Power Queryはデータが増えたり、列が増えたりしても問題ない。 VBAだと、増えることを想定した作りにする必要がある。 #PowerBI #PowerQuery #PBIJP pic.twitter.com/HlDsXmMORf

2019-02-02 13:18:38
拡大
Yellow11 @br_Yellow11

Power Queryはデータの取り込みは基本、早くできない。 特にデータの集計をPower Query上で集計をすると余計に遅くなる。 #PowerBI #PowerQuery #PBIJP

2019-02-02 13:19:43
Yellow11 @br_Yellow11

Power Queryの式はリボンUIでポチポチしてもいいが、出来れば数式バーで中身を見ながら作った方がいい。 #PowerBI #PowerQuery #PBIJP pic.twitter.com/BE7AIhA2e4

2019-02-02 13:21:34
拡大
Yellow11 @br_Yellow11

= {1..1000} 1から1000までのリスト生成 お、出来た(´・ω・`) #PowerBI #PowerQuery #PBIJP pic.twitter.com/jBT702r1Uh

2019-02-02 13:23:29
拡大
Hiro @mofumofu_dance

@br_Yellow11 おー。知らなかった。2n-1とかできるんですかね?

2019-02-02 13:30:45
Hiro @mofumofu_dance

@PowerBIxyz @br_Yellow11 どっちですかww 試してみます!

2019-02-02 13:56:42
Yellow11 @br_Yellow11

@PowerBIxyz @mofumofu_dance List.Generateでぽちぽちやれば出来るそうですん(´・ω・`) List.Accumulateでも出来るけどList.Generateの方が使いやすいですってー docs.microsoft.com/en-us/powerque…

2019-02-02 13:58:42
Yellow11 @br_Yellow11

列名をnullにしたら自動的にColumn1から連番で列名が付けられる。 ちょっとした物作る時に便利ね。 #PowerBI #PowerQuery #PBIJP

2019-02-02 13:25:35
Yellow11 @br_Yellow11

行ごとの計算ではなく、列の縦方向の計算をしたい場合は一旦リストにしてあげる必要がある。 #PowerBI #PowerQuery #PBIJP

2019-02-02 13:36:30
Yellow11 @br_Yellow11

強制的にデータをバッファする関数 List.buffer Table.buffer データの更新が遅い場合、ソースの処理にこの関数を使うと大量のメモリ消費と引き換えに読み込みが早くなる場合がある。 #PowerBI #PowerQuery #PBIJP

2019-02-02 13:48:34
Yellow11 @br_Yellow11

お次はお馴染み小室さん Power Queryで計算は遅くなるからあまりしない方がいいよーって言うけど、したい時もあるじゃない?みたいなお話 #PowerBI #PowerQuery #PBIJP

2019-02-02 14:16:28
Yellow11 @br_Yellow11

クエリをマージしたり、列をグループ化したり、Power Queryは自由な順番で出来る。 では、これをどういう順番でやれば軽くなるのか。 #PowerBI #PowerQuery #PBIJP pic.twitter.com/7eig2ZHn5u

2019-02-02 14:18:36
拡大
Yellow11 @br_Yellow11

こっちより 1.列をグループ化 2.クエリをマージ これの方が微妙に早い 1.クエリをマージ 2.列をグループ化 ビッグデータとかだと3割ぐらい高速化するかも #PowerBI #PowerQuery #PBIJP

2019-02-02 14:37:31
Yellow11 @br_Yellow11

お次はPower BIでスクレイピングのお話 #PowerBI #PowerQuery #PBIJP

2019-02-02 14:38:53
Yellow11 @br_Yellow11

スクレイピングやクローリングはWebページの規約で禁止されている可能性があるから注意してね!(/・ω・)/ #PowerBI #PowerQuery #PBIJP

2019-02-02 14:39:43
Yellow11 @br_Yellow11

Yahooファイナンスの日経平均株価チャートを取得してみる。 Web.Page関数を使います #PowerBI #PowerQuery #PBIJP docs.microsoft.com/en-us/powerque…

2019-02-02 14:42:29